• 既然操作系统层已经提供了page cache的功能,为什么还要在应用层加缓存?_那曲网站建设_网站建设公司_网站建设设计制作_seo优化
    • 网站首页

      home
    • 既然操作系统层已经提供了page cache的功能,为什么还要在应用层加缓存?_那曲网站建设_网站建设公司_网站建设设计制作_seo优化
    • 清原镇

      清原镇
    • 清原镇
    • 赤水镇

      赤水镇
    • 赤水镇
    • 迟营乡

      迟营乡
    • 迟营乡
    • 永岁乡

      永岁乡
    • 永岁乡
    • 团溪镇

      团溪镇
    • 团溪镇
    • 榆林市

      榆林市
    • 榆林市

    咨询服务热线:

      清原镇 赤水镇 迟营乡 永岁乡 团溪镇 榆林市
  • 位置:当前位置: 首页 >

      既然操作系统层已经提供了page cache的功能,为什么还要在应用层加缓存?

      发布日期:2025-06-24 17:50:12阅读:次

      page cache主要是面对磁盘I/O这块,尤其在顺序I/O场景,很好利用到局部性原理(包括空间和时间两个维度),能极高I/O读写效率。

      应该说innodb的b+树(读写均衡或读密集型),lsm树(高并发写密集型),kafka顺序日志(高吞吐量消息)都是很好利用这一点。

      至于应用层的缓存,从局部性原理来说,都是一样的。

      就是把最近时间和范围内,经常用到的数据缓存起来,减少系统的压力。

      不同之处在于,应用层缓存的是业务数据,这个数据可…。

      既然操作系统层已经提供了page cache的功能,为什么还要在应用层加缓存?
    • 上一篇 : 你在什么情况下需要写 shell ?
    • 下一篇 : 我是新手想养鱼,预算不超过200。有什么好的建议或者禁忌吗。?
  • 友情链接:

    网站首页 丨 清原镇 丨 赤水镇 丨 迟营乡 丨 永岁乡 丨 团溪镇 丨 榆林市 丨

    版权@|备案:粤IP*******|网站地图 备案号:

  • 关注我们